Recently, Polish productions have enjoyed incredible interest among Netflix users. Last week, as many as 5 films were included in the TOP10 most frequently watched on the platform. Now the list has expanded to include more titles that until recently were hits in cinemas. Will they repeat their success also in streaming?

It is impossible not to notice that in recent years Polish cinema has started to get back on track and more and more productions are gaining recognition from both viewers and critics. For some time now, the company has also been showing interest in domestic works, not only willingly establishing cooperation with local creators, but also purchasing licenses for the distribution of the most desired titles. On May 9, 2024, a situation occurred that had never happened before in the history of the website. The TOP10 most frequently watched films on the platform included as many as . Viewers eagerly reached for the political thriller “Hunting” or the controversial Szymon Gonera. “Baby Boom, or Kogel Mogel”, the biography of the renowned singer “Wodecki, I like to go back to where I was” and the satirical drama “Piep*zyc Mickiewicza” with Dawid Ogrodnik in the main role also aroused considerable interest. However, you had to wait a while for its debut in streaming, because Jan Brzechwa’s fairy tales were available in the Netflix library only on May 8, 2024. The story about the fate of Ada, a student of the magical school of an eccentric professor, whom he portrayed on screen, immediately intrigued viewers and immediately began to break records. Currently, it is at the top of the TOP10 most popular titles on the website, and its popularity is not weakening, but increasing.

Second place was taken by Michał Węgrzyn’s crime comedy “How I stole 100 million” with Mateusz Damięcki, Antoni Królikowski, Michał Żebrowski and in the main roles. The 2022 biographical drama film “Marusarz. Tatrzański Orzeł” also aroused great interest, showing the fate of the outstanding ski jumper Stanisław Marusarz, who was a courier and second lieutenant of the Home Army during the war. The full list of the most watched films on Netflix in Poland on May 14, 2024 is as follows:

  1. “Mr. Kleks’ Academy”
  2. “How I Stole 100 Million”
  3. “Mother of the Bride”
  4. “The Spanish Courier”
  5. “Hunting”
  6. “Influencer’s Girl”
  7. “Marusarz. Tatra eagle”
  8. “Baby Boom, or Kogel Mogel”
  9. “Mercy”
  10. “Barbarian”
